OptiTROP-Lung05 Trial Explores New Frontier for First-Line ADC-ICI Combinations in NSCLC
The OptiTROP-Lung05 clinical trial is investigating whether it can establish a new standard for first-line treatment of non-small cell lung cancer (NSCLC) by combining antibody-drug conjugates (ADCs) with immune checkpoint inhibitors (ICIs). This research aims to determine if this combination therapy offers superior efficacy and safety compared to existing treatment options for patients newly diagnosed with NSCLC. The trial's design and early results are being closely watched by oncologists and researchers in the field. The potential for ADCs to deliver targeted chemotherapy directly to cancer cells, while ICIs boost the body's immune response against the tumor, presents a promising synergistic approach.
